Why saving money takes willpower

Saving money is something that we all have to do if we want a little bit of financial security. It isn’t the easiest thing in the world to do though. All It takes is to see that one thing that we want and we want it now. We spend the money that we intended to save and promise ourselves that we will save twice as much when we get the next paycheck. It never happens that way.


It takes a lot of willpower to save money. If we don’t have any willpower, that money will continue to be spent on the things that we want. It is alright to buy things that we want. In fact, it’s a good idea to do that every now and then. However, if you ever want to save anything at all, you will have to have the willpower to pass by that thing that we want a lot of the time.


The easiest thing to do when you know that you have money is to buy something. Some of us don’t have any willpower at all. We spend every penny we have as soon as we have it. It isn’t wise to do, we know that, but we do it anyway. Other people can save all their money because they don’t buy anything they want. There is a happy medium in there though. Buy some of the things that you want, but don’t buy them all. You have to think of the bigger picture. What do you want to save the money for? How long will it take and is the item you are thinking about buying now worth putting off the future item for longer? If it isn’t, then you know that you have to leave the item on the shelf.


That is when you need the willpower. You need it to pass up those things that you really shouldn’t buy now in order to save for what you want later on. It’s as simple as that. If you don’t have any willpower, you will never save for the bigger things that you want. It is just like when you want to lose weight. You have to have the willpower to stop eating the things that you know will make you gain weight. If you don’t, you will just continue to gain weight. If you don’t have willpower to pass up things that you want to buy, your money will never grow the way you want to.


You can make plans for savings all you want. You might even do it for a while, but if you don’t have willpower, you will never save money. Make a pact with yourself to save money and do it by finding the willpower to do it. You have to have the will to do it and that will give you the power that you need to see it through.
